100 Thieves has drawn much attention recently, with
their last split in the LTA North marked by sudden roster changes and a rough start to their first few series. After adding NA toplane veteran
Niship āDhoklaā Doshi to the team in his first ever coaching position, the team went 0-2 while starting young toplaner
Rayan "Sniper" Shoura. They quickly brought Dhokla off of the coaching staff and onto the starting roster, just days after he initially joined. After his 100T debut, a Saturday loss vs.
Shopify Rebellion (SR), Dhokla sat down with Sheep Esports to talk about his new team, his future as a player or coach, his namesake food, and more.
You played against your old teammates, Cristian "Palafox" Palafox and Juan "Contractz" Garcia, who you played with for years on CLG and NRG. You also supported SR as a costreamer, but now youāre up against them. How does that feel?
Niship āDhoklaā Doshi: "Feels fun. Iām just versing my friends, so I want to win against them and shit on them. Game 1, we did a good job of that, but the rest of the series... I got a little too excited on the top play with Sion, and then we ended up losing. But itās all good. I had fun, though obviously it doesnāt do well for our chances."
You joined the LCS years ago on OpTic Gaming. Since then, youāve gone back to Academy for a few years, then back to LCS, just recently into coaching, and now youāre back again already. Do you get a sense of whiplash going back and forth, or are you used to everything by now?
Dhokla: Iām kind of used to it, but Iām also just grateful for the opportunities that I have. Not being on a team at the start of the year obviously didnāt feel good, and I had a quarter-life crisis, like āwhat do I want to do now?ā because League has pretty much been my whole adult life. I had no idea what to do, so Iām glad I got this opportunity, and just want to make the most of it.
Do you see your future in coaching, as 100 Thieves originally hired you for, or were you always planning on a return to pro play, and this just came sooner than expected?
Dhokla: I think I want to do coaching once Iām terrible at the game, but I donāt think Iām there yet. As long as I can play, I will try to play, and if not, then Iāll go into coaching. But I feel like Iāll always have that drive to be a player and not a coach, because I always grind a lot. In my head, Iām still in player mode.
How good was Ibrahim "Fudge" Allami today in the toplane? He had a pretty good start on Gwen, but you managed to win that game. Did you feel a lot of pressure from him in particular?
Dhokla: He did fine; I think I was just a little too aggressive. In the first game, I took some tower shots. In the Sion game, I was doing well, and I just trolled the game on the top dive. In the last game, the swap scenario kind of put me behind, and Iām playing a comp where weāre just completely outscaled. I think if our drafts were a little bit better, at least in Game 3 ā Game 2, if I didnāt grief the game top, we wouldāve been in a really good spot. They didnāt have a tank killer, with Ezreal as their AD Carry, so the game wouldāve been simple if Iād just played normal.
One thing you bring to 100 Thieves is another dimension to the teamās drafting. You not only have stability picks, like todayās Sion, but also skill with Irelia and many soloqueue games this split on Jayce. Do you think youāll take a carry role on the team going forward?
Dhokla: Iāll play whatever I think is good. Itās hard to get Irelia in good spots right now, but Jayce is more of a four-five game in Fearless type of pick. Once most of the tanks are out, then you can pick Jayce, so it depends on the Fearless Draft format. But Iām willing to play everything, honestly, and Iām glad my coaches have given me the freedom to pursue that. Especially in Fearless, they donāt really say ānoā on my picks, so I like that.
